一、安裝jdk
1.卸載舊版或系統自帶的jdk
(1)列出所有已安裝的jdk
rpm -qa | grep jdk
(2)卸載不需要的jdk
yum -y remove 安裝套件名稱
2.下載並解壓縮jdk
(1)下載安裝包
進入到/usr/local目錄下新java目錄
mkdir java
,在java目錄下使用wget指令下載安裝包,如
wget --no-cookies --no-check-certificate --header "cookie: gpw_e24=http%3a%2f%2fwww.oracle.com%2f; oraclelicense=accept-securebackup-cookie" http://download.oracle.com/otn-pub/java/jdk/8u141-b15/336fa29ff2bb4ef291e347e091f7f4a7/jdk-8u141-linux-x64.tar.gz
或使用shell工具在本地下好上傳至linux。
(2)解壓縮安裝套件
下載完成後使用指令解壓縮,
tar -zxvf 壓縮套件名稱
#3 .設定環境變數
進入/etc/ 資料夾下使用vim profile 指令編輯器編輯profile檔案(全域環境變數設定)。如果沒有profile文件,則去/root下設定.bash_profile檔案(目前使用者下的環境變數設定)在檔案最後添上如下設定:(擔心修改出錯可使用ps指令將檔案備份) <br/>
#export java_home=jdk安装包的根目录 export path=$java_home/bin:$path export classpath=.:$java_home/lib/dt.jar:$java_home/lib/tools.jar:$java_home/jre/lib/rt.jar
最後不要忘記執行指令
source /etc/profile
使設定檔生效。
輸入 java -version 查看jdk設定是否成功。出現版本資訊則jdk安裝配置完成。
二、安裝tomcat
2.下載並解壓縮tomcat
(1)下載安裝套件
進入到/usr /local目錄下新建mywork目錄
mkdir mywork
,在mywork目錄下使用wget指令下載安裝包,如
wget "" <br/>
或使用shell工具在本地下好上傳至linux。
(2)解壓縮安裝套件
下載完成後使用指令解壓縮,
tar -zxvf 壓縮套件名稱
#3 .啟動tomcat<br/>
進入到tomcat主目錄,啟動tomcat,使用命令
bin/startup.sh
# 查看tomcat是否啟動成功(進程是否存在),使用命令
ps -ef | grep tomcat
4.查看tomcat是否安裝成功
#(1)查看防火牆狀態
systemctl status firewalld
上面指令無效時使用指令
service iptables status
#
service iptables status#
##夫(2)關閉linux防火牆
systemctl stop firewalld
上面命令無效時使用命令
service iptables stop
(3)查看linux的ip位址資訊
ifconfig
(4)存取tomcat
瀏覽器輸入位址,位址: 8080
三、安裝mysql1.卸載系統自帶的資料庫mariadb
yum list installed | grep mariadb (查看系统是否安装了mariadb) yum -y remove 应用名称 (卸载mariadb)
2.下載並解壓縮mysql
(1)下載安裝包 進入到/usr/local目錄下,使用wget指令下載安裝包,如
wget "http://dev.mysql.com/get/ downloads/mysql-5.7/mysql-5.7.17-linux-glibc2.5-x86_64.tar.gz"
或使用shell工具在本地下好上傳至linux。 (2)解壓縮安裝套件
下載完成後使用指令解壓縮,
tar -zxvf 壓縮套件名稱
<br/>
解壓完成後更改檔案名稱,<br/>
mv 解壓縮檔名mysql<br/>
3.建立資料倉儲目錄<br/>
mkdir /mysql/data (此目錄存放資料庫資料)<br/>
4.建立mysql使用者及使用者群組groupadd mysql (创建用户组) useradd -r -s /sbin/nologin -g mysql mysql -d /usr/local/mysql (将mysql用户添加至组中并为用户指定mysql目录)
进入到mysql根目录 cd /usr/local/mysql 改变目录所有者, chown -r mysql . (不要忘记后面的.) chgrp -r mysql . chown -r mysql /mysql/data
6.初始化mysql設定參數
在mysql根目录下执行, bin/mysqld --initialize --user=mysql --basedir=/usr/local/mysql --datadir=/mysql/data 注意:命令执行后在末尾处会生成初始密码,将其复制到记事本中用于后面首次登录。 设置数据加密, bin/mysql_ssl_rsa_setup --datadir=/mysql/data
将mysql配置文件添加到系统配置文件中,进入目录 cd /usr/local/mysql/support-files 复制, cp my-default.cnf /etc/my.cnf cp mysql.server /etc/init.d/mysql 编辑mysql配置文件,指定基础目录和数据目录, vim /etc/init.d/mysql 修改如下属性: basedir=/usr/local/mysql datadir=/mysql/data
启动mysql, /etc/init.d/mysql start --5.0版本是 mysqld start 登录, mysql -h localhost -u root -p 输入第(6)步拿到的密码。如果出现:-bash :mysql :commond not found 就执行:ln -s /usr/local/mysql/bin/mysql /usr/bin --创建命令软连接 修改密码, set password=password('你要设置的密码')
賦予所有主機所有權限
<br/>
grant all privileges on *.* to 'root'@'%' identified by 'root';
<br/>
##flush privileges;<br/>
查看使用者表格權限<br/>
use mysql; select * from user;
10.新增系統環境變數<br/>
#在最後新增:
<br/><br/>
export path=/usr/local/mysql/bin:$path
以上是如何在Linux系統上建置Java Web專案運行環境?的詳細內容。更多資訊請關注PHP中文網其他相關文章!